Output 0abfba14f2c57cff4f4eefdc31bc7d559d55fed32647fb13d0ecd6bd0edbbb4b:1

value
18376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f0b7cf26b4148c1c21964153e5a57e53799e618 OP_EQUAL
address
3K7AkPVyZb4b7cwQjMG6XgQ9zdsPQnWzxy
transaction
0abfba14f2c57cff4f4eefdc31bc7d559d55fed32647fb13d0ecd6bd0edbbb4b
confirmations
272585
spent
true